Core Viewpoint - The article discusses the process and requirements for claiming continuing education tax deductions in China, emphasizing the importance of proper documentation and adherence to specified guidelines [6]. Group 1: Continuing Education Tax Deductions - Taxpayers can deduct continuing education expenses for degree programs at a fixed rate of 400 yuan per month during the education period, with a maximum deduction period of 48 months for the same degree [3][4]. - For vocational qualification continuing education, taxpayers can deduct expenses in the year they obtain the relevant certification [3][4]. Group 2: Application Process - The application process involves selecting the deduction year, entering personal information, and providing details about the continuing education undertaken [2][3]. - Taxpayers must upload relevant supporting documents after filling out the required information about their continuing education [4].
